Go-разработчик (Middle)
- Разработка и поддержка высоконагруженных микросервисов на Go
- Оптимизация производительности существующего кода
- Интеграция с внешними сервисами и API
- Участие в проектировании архитектуры и выработке решений для новых и текущих задач
- Написание unit- и интеграционных тестов для обеспечения стабильности кода
- Взаимодействие с другими командами (дизайн, DevOps, аналитика) для создания качественного продукта
- Опыт коммерческой разработки на Go от 1 лет
- Понимание принципов построения микросервисной архитектуры
- Опыт работы с реляционными и/или PostgreSQL базами данных (например,MySQL, MongoDB)
- Уверенное знание и опыт работы с REST и gRPC API
- Опыт написания тестов и понимание TDD подхода
- Опыт работы с системой контроля версий Git
- Базовые знания Docker и контейнеризации приложений
Будет плюсом
- Опыт работы с Kubernetes и CI/CD пайплайнами
- Понимание принципов асинхронного программирования и опыт работы с очередями сообщений (например, Kafka, RabbitMQ)
- Знание других языков программирования, таких как Python или JavaScript
- Умение работать с облачными провайдерами (AWS, GCP, Azure)
Условия:
Мы — Cerebro Innovation Technologies, занимаемся разработкой высоконагруженных приложений. В нашей команде работают профессионалы, ориентированные на создание продуктов с высокой производительностью и отказоустойчивостью. Мы ценим качество кода, командную работу и желание постоянно учиться.
Мы предлагаем возможность профессионального и карьерного роста, а также участие в интересных и перспективных проектах.
Обслуживать клиентов: работать со счетами, пластиковыми картами и денежными переводами. Продавать банковские и страховые продукты (кредитные продукты, карты, вклады).
Обслуживать клиентов: работать со счетами, пластиковыми картами и денежными переводами. Продавать банковские и страховые продукты (кредитные продукты, карты, вклады).